Tim Xu is a first-year medical student at Johns Hopkins School of Medicine. He recently graduated from Vanderbilt University, where he majored in Neuroscience and Modern European Studies and studied abroad at Sciences Po in Paris. Tim joined The Journal of Young Investigators in August 2009 as an Associate Editor in the Biological and Biomedical Sciences and was appointed to serve as Director of Public Relations in April 2010 before becoming Editor in Chief in March 2011. He has had experience with behavioral, genetic, biochemical, and neuroimaging techniques applied to the study of depression, OCD, and schizophrenia. In his free time, Tim enjoys swimming, ping-pong, and movie soundtracks.
